Decorated Blister:
A flat, die-cut plastic blank is erected on a blister card sealer, creating a package for maximum consumer appeal. BlisterPlus blanks can be produced with perforations, windows, or hinged reclosable openings. Imprinting can be done using offset, flexographic, or silkscreen printing, as well as hot or cold stamping and embossing. AGI/ Klearfold, Warrington, PA.
Lipstick Package:
For its Moisture Stay lipstick, Revlon wanted an elegant package in its custom gold color that shone like a piece of jewelry. Risdon-AMS satisfied RevlonÕs requirements with a lipstick case that features a high-purity aluminum outer shell anodized in gold, a case with center bands that contain four beads in a 50-50 round configuration, and a cap and base that are silky smooth to the touch. Engineered for smooth action and consistent torque, Risdon-AMSÕs ColorTouch system prevents pomade retraction or pushback during application and requires only one revolution to fully advance the lipstick. The systemÕs cartridge components are made of styrenics and acetal. The metal components are produced in Risdon-AMSÕs Watertown, CT, facility, while the plastic components are made in the companyÕs Barie, Canada plant. The components are assembled in Risdon-AMSÕs Danbury, CT, facility. Risdon-AMS, Watertown, CT.
Shrink Films:
Paco Rabanne chose an OPS shrink film for its Ultraviolet perfume bottles. The Sleever can be applied to a wide range of container shapes to expand design options. The film, which has metallic pigments and dichromatic varnishes that result in an iridescent appearance, is protected from abrasions. It can be formed into a tearable tab without perforations, which protects a container from tampering. Invisible devices for tracing that are incorporated into the film protect products from counterfeiting. Sleever International, Morangis, France.
Glossy Films:
Films are suited for a wide range of package decorating applications. Fasson POLYplus 250, which was chosen for the physique line of hair products, is available white or clear as an alternative to polyethylene and biaxially oriented polypropylene films. The highly conformable film is made from a 2.5-mil coextruded polyolefin glossy facestock, and is durable at high throughput speeds. Avery Dennison, Fasson Roll North America, Painesville, OH.
